The Spine revisited: an updated clinical approach to back and neck pain (MODULE 1)

Spine-related pain represents one of the top public health problems worldwide. From the old times, a huge variety of professionals have used Manual Therapy (MT) as an intervention to treat back and neck pain.
Based on a comprehensive literature search, this two-module course will present to the students the most updated information in regard of the main spine-related conditions. The focus will be place on clinical presentations and differential diagnosis in order to improve our clinical reasoning skills.
The course will be delivered in a dynamic and interactive way alternating short theoretical presentations with hands-on related practice. The most updated evidence will be presented and discussed with the students and examples based on real clinical situations will also be provided.
